## Abstract Protein elution curves in ion exchange chromatography (IEC) were simulated with a rate model. Three pure proteins and their mixture were used (Ξ±βlactalbumin, BSA, and conalbumin) under different operational conditions. The anionic matrix QβSepharose FF was used packed in a 1βmL column.
